CheckBox 

Jun 13, 2012 10:18 AM

 


Component definition

This component allows you to place a checkbox on your webpage. Checkboxes are often used to allow users an easy way to answer yes/no questions.

Definition of component input value or values

This component has no direct input values; however, a variable initialized prior to the form component on which the checkbox is placed can be used as the "Output Data" variable.  This will result in the checkbox assuming the value state of that variable at the time the page loads.

Definition of component output value or values

The output variable of the CheckBox component is a boolean (logical, true/false) datatype.

Component settings

To setup this component, first specify your style information (and the text you wish to display on the checkbox). Then, specify whether or not you want to use output paths. Specify a variable to hold the data the user selects with the checkbox. Also, if required, specify a default state to use BEFORE the user has entered data.

Use case

Checkboxes are used commonly for yes/no questions, such as "check all that apply." Other examples include "Do you want to receive our email newsletter?"
